Ang Ulila
Sa maruming damit na aking suot
akoy nag lalakad sa isang kalsada
bawat makasalubong aking hinihingan
Ale! mama! kunting tinapay po lamang
Hinde pa ako nag aalmusal
Lulubong na naman ang araw
Buti pa yuong mga Ibong nabubusog
sila sa mga Uod
Buti pa yung mga bulaklak nabubusog
sila sa ulang at hamog
Sa matinding Pagod, akoy napaupo't
Napa-idlip lamang
Nang maramdaman ko ang sikat ng araw
Sinabi sa sarili
Salamat po JESUS panaginip lang pala!

Filipino students are often motivated by a desire to achieve academic success as a way to fulfill their personal goals and expectations of their family. Additionally, the strong influence of societal norms that place a high value on education and the belief that a good education leads to better job opportunities motivate Filipino students to excel in their studies. Finally, the sense of responsibility to give back to their families and communities through their educational achievements can also be a strong motivation for Filipino students.
